21st Century Classrooms with 20th Century Learning Theories
See on Scoop.it - Education Technology
The 20th century brought forth several changes in the field of education. These changes include teaching methods and pedagogies, teaching and learning theories, and new perspectives on where America’s education is heading. In the 21st century, classrooms called online classrooms or virtual classrooms are emerging in vast numbers, all accessible 24/7, across towns and cities and certainly across the nations. Still, how much can 21st century classrooms benefit from 20th century theories?

iBook Textbooks now available in 51 countries worldwide as Apple pushes for interactive learning
See on Scoop.it - Education Technology
Steve Jobs dreamed of making paper textbooks obsolete. Apple has pursued that vision for years with iBooks Textbooks, which today expanded into new markets across Asia, Latin America, and Europe.

15% of U.S. teachers now use Remind101 to text students and their parents
See on Scoop.it - Education Technology
Remind101 announced today that it has raised $15 million for its free platform that gives teachers a safe way to send text messages to students and stay in touch with parents.
